Transactional intellectual property law 

We offer legal advice on intellectual property rights

Innovations and new business models based entirely on information, knowledge and intellectual property rights create challenges for companies in terms of how to manage contracts and comply with intellectual property regulations. Our lawyers help you create value from your intellectual property assets efficiently and assess the risks of every individual agreement, for example patent licensing agreements or research and development agreements.

How we can help you deal with questions related to commercialisation of intellectual property rights

Our lawyers bring together academic excellence and extensive commercial experience, so they can confidently help you draft, negotiate and enforce a variety of IP agreements. Our lawyers have extensive experience of transactional intellectual property law with a particular focus on technology transfer and commercialisation of intellectual property assets. We can help you with:

  • Transitional agreements in IP-related business transactions
  • Licensing agreements
  • Manufacturing and distribution agreements
  • Franchise agreements
  • Confidentiality agreements
  • Research and development agreements
  • Cooperation agreements where intellectual property assets are strategically important

Many of our lawyers have worked as in-house counsel in both Swedish and international companies. We have also played a key role in several high-profile and ground-breaking corporate transactions in the field of intellectual property law. We have the lawyers who are among the leading authors in the Nordic region in transactional intellectual property law, which allows us to bring cutting-edge knowledge in the field of licensing and assignment of intellectual property rights.

Lawyers with specialist experience in intellectual property law

Our law firm has the experience to offer a wide range of expertise and tailor-made advice within several areas of the law. We help companies in all sectors. Our clients include companies in the following sectors: life sciences, food, clothing, telecommunications, media, energy and manufacturing. We also work with advertising agencies and other providers in the advertising, PR, branding, design or digital marketing sectors.

Our lawyers in various specialist areas of commercial law work closely together, which allows us to offer you strategic advice in all areas where intellectual property assets are important, for example commercial contracts, private and public M&A, competition law, IT law and tax law.

Find out more about Vinge

If you want to find out more about Vinge or our other practice areas, you will find more information here. >

Microsoft.CSharp.RuntimeBinder.RuntimeBinderException: Cannot convert null to 'int' because it is a non-nullable value type
   at CallSite.Target(Closure , CallSite , Object )
   at System.Dynamic.UpdateDelegates.UpdateAndExecute1[T0,TRet](CallSite site, T0 arg0)
   at CallSite.Target(Closure , CallSite , Object )
   at ASP._Page_app_plugins_vinge_grideditors_latest_Latest_cshtml.<>c.<Execute>b__3_10(Object x) in C:\Website\Vinge\app_plugins\vinge\grideditors\latest\Latest.cshtml:line 100
   at System.Linq.Enumerable.WhereSelectListIterator`2.MoveNext()
   at System.Collections.Generic.List`1..ctor(IEnumerable`1 collection)
   at System.Linq.Enumerable.ToList[TSource](IEnumerable`1 source)
   at ASP._Page_app_plugins_vinge_grideditors_latest_Latest_cshtml.Execute() in C:\Website\Vinge\app_plugins\vinge\grideditors\latest\Latest.cshtml:line 100
   at System.Web.WebPages.WebPageBase.ExecutePageHierarchy()
   at System.Web.Mvc.WebViewPage.ExecutePageHierarchy()
   at System.Web.WebPages.WebPageBase.ExecutePageHierarchy(WebPageContext pageContext, TextWriter writer, WebPageRenderingBase startPage)
   at Umbraco.Web.Mvc.ProfilingView.Render(ViewContext viewContext, TextWriter writer) in D:\a\1\s\src\Umbraco.Web\Mvc\ProfilingView.cs:line 25
   at System.Web.Mvc.Html.PartialExtensions.Partial(HtmlHelper htmlHelper, String partialViewName, Object model, ViewDataDictionary viewData)
   at ASP._Page_Views_Partials_grid_editors_Base_cshtml.Execute() in C:\Website\Vinge\Views\Partials\grid\editors\Base.cshtml:line 20
Microsoft.CSharp.RuntimeBinder.RuntimeBinderException: Cannot convert null to 'int' because it is a non-nullable value type
   at CallSite.Target(Closure , CallSite , Object )
   at ASP._Page_app_plugins_vinge_grideditors_latest_Latest_cshtml.<>c.<Execute>b__3_10(Object x) in C:\Website\Vinge\app_plugins\vinge\grideditors\latest\Latest.cshtml:line 100
   at System.Linq.Enumerable.WhereSelectListIterator`2.MoveNext()
   at System.Collections.Generic.List`1..ctor(IEnumerable`1 collection)
   at System.Linq.Enumerable.ToList[TSource](IEnumerable`1 source)
   at ASP._Page_app_plugins_vinge_grideditors_latest_Latest_cshtml.Execute() in C:\Website\Vinge\app_plugins\vinge\grideditors\latest\Latest.cshtml:line 100
   at System.Web.WebPages.WebPageBase.ExecutePageHierarchy()
   at System.Web.Mvc.WebViewPage.ExecutePageHierarchy()
   at System.Web.WebPages.WebPageBase.ExecutePageHierarchy(WebPageContext pageContext, TextWriter writer, WebPageRenderingBase startPage)
   at Umbraco.Web.Mvc.ProfilingView.Render(ViewContext viewContext, TextWriter writer) in D:\a\1\s\src\Umbraco.Web\Mvc\ProfilingView.cs:line 25
   at System.Web.Mvc.Html.PartialExtensions.Partial(HtmlHelper htmlHelper, String partialViewName, Object model, ViewDataDictionary viewData)
   at ASP._Page_Views_Partials_grid_editors_Base_cshtml.Execute() in C:\Website\Vinge\Views\Partials\grid\editors\Base.cshtml:line 20